Common fixed point results under w-distance with applications to nonlinear integral equations and nonlinear fractional Differential Equations
In this article, we prove some new common fixed point results under the generalized contraction condition using w-distance and weak altering distance functions. Also, the validity of the results is demonstrated by an example along with numerical experiment for approximating the common fixed point. Later, as applications, the unique common solutions for the system of nonlinear Fredholm integral equations, nonlinear Volterra integral equations and nonlinear fractional differential equations of Caputo type are derived.
